December 12th, 2019
A lawmaker of the opposition Socialists on Thursday harshly criticised the situation surrounding Hungarian hospitals and health care as outrageous and "chaotic", in light of a recent law passed by parliament. "What we have seen in the sector just this year are endless waiting lists, shortage of doctors and nurses, mass vacancies, closed-down wards, hospital-care related infection, unpaid hospital bills and graft," Ildiko Borbely Bango told a press conference. She said that tens of thousands of patients die in Hungary each year because they do not get sufficient care. Hospitals have in addition amassed 70 billion forints (EUR 213m) worth of debt, which jeopardises proper care and tens of thousands of jobs in the hospital suppliers' sector, she added.
